Sarah Attkinson "testifieth thatt Some time in the Spring of the year about Eighteen years Since Susanna Martin came unto our house att Newbury from Amsbury in an Extraordinary dirty Season, w'n She came into our house I asked whether she came from Amsbury a fot She Sayd She did I asked how She could come in this time a foott and bid my children make way for her to come to the fire to dry her selfe She replyed She was as dry as I was and turn'd her Coats on Side, and I could nott pceive thatt the Soule of her Shows were wett I was startled att itt that she should come soe dry and told her thatt I should have been wett up to my knees if I Should have come So farr on foott she replyed thatt She scorn'd to have a drabled tayle.". I have spoken nothing else. Along with others accused, she was stripped naked and her body searched for the incriminating witchs teat. This court-appointed deputation found her body free of abnormal excrescences, but observed her breasts "In the morning search appeared to us very full, the nipples fresh and starting, now at this searching all lank and pendant," implying she had fed her familiar[17] between searches. She was born to Richard North and Joan Bartram North and baptized in Olney, Buckinghamshire, England on September 30, 1621. Joseph Knight testified that around 20 October 1686, Susanna had picked up a dog running at her side and changed it into a "Kegg or halfe feirkin".
